wearable Definition
- 1able to be worn; suitable or designed for wearing
- 2a piece of technology worn on the body that can track various health and fitness data

Summary: wearable in Brief
The term 'wearable' [ˈwɛrəbəl] refers to something that can be worn, such as clothing or accessories. It also refers to a type of technology that can be worn on the body, such as fitness trackers or smartwatches. Examples include 'The dress is not wearable in this weather.' and 'The company has developed a new line of wearables that can monitor heart rate and sleep patterns.' Phrases like 'wearable art' and 'wearable technology' denote clothing or jewelry designed as a work of art or electronic devices that can perform various functions.
